Downloading and Installing WhatsApp for Windows
Okay, first things first, you need to download the WhatsApp application for your Windows computer. Don't worry; it's a straightforward process. Just follow these simple steps, and you'll be chatting away on your PC in no time!
First things first, to get started, open your favorite web browser – Chrome, Firefox, Edge, whatever floats your boat. Then, head over to the official WhatsApp website. Make sure you're on the real deal to avoid any dodgy downloads. Look for the download button, and click on the Windows version. The site should automatically detect that you are running windows and suggest the appropriate download link. Once the download is complete, you'll find the installation file, usually in your Downloads folder. Double-click on it to start the installation process. Give WhatsApp permission to make changes to your device when prompted – this is a standard security measure. The installation wizard will guide you through the remaining steps. Just follow the on-screen instructions, which usually involve agreeing to the terms and conditions and choosing an installation location. Once the installation is complete, you should see the WhatsApp icon on your desktop or in your Start menu. Click on it to launch the app. Now, here’s where the fun begins! The WhatsApp Windows app will display a QR code on your screen. This QR code is your key to linking your phone to your computer. Grab your smartphone, open WhatsApp, and tap on the three dots (or the settings icon, depending on your phone) to access the menu. Look for the "Linked Devices" option and tap on it. You'll see a button that says "Link a Device." Tap on that button, and your phone's camera will activate, ready to scan the QR code on your computer screen. Point your phone's camera at the QR code displayed on your WhatsApp Windows app. Make sure the entire QR code is within the frame. Once your phone scans the QR code, your WhatsApp account will automatically appear on your Windows app. And boom, you are done! You can now send and receive messages, share files, and make voice or video calls directly from your computer. It's as simple as that! Linking Your Phone to WhatsApp Desktop
Linking your phone to the WhatsApp desktop application is how you sync your WhatsApp account from your mobile device to your computer. The WhatsApp desktop application does not function independently; it mirrors the messages and contacts from your phone. This seamless integration allows you to send and receive messages, share files, and make calls from your computer while keeping everything synchronized with your phone. Let's dive into the specifics.
First, ensure that your phone is connected to the internet and has the latest version of WhatsApp installed. This is crucial because outdated versions may not support the linking feature properly. The desktop app requires an active WhatsApp account on your phone to mirror conversations and contacts. With your phone ready, launch the WhatsApp application on your Windows computer. Upon opening the app, you will be greeted with a QR code displayed prominently on the screen. This QR code is unique to your device and serves as the key to linking your phone to the desktop app. On your smartphone, open WhatsApp and navigate to the settings menu. On iPhones, you can find the settings option at the bottom right corner of the screen. On Android devices, tap on the three vertical dots located at the top right corner to access the menu. Within the settings menu, look for the "Linked Devices" option. This is where you manage all the devices connected to your WhatsApp account. Tap on the "Linked Devices" option to proceed. Next, tap on the "Link a Device" button. This action will activate your phone's camera, preparing it to scan the QR code displayed on your computer screen. Point your phone's camera at the QR code on your computer screen. Ensure that the entire QR code is visible within the camera frame. Once the QR code is successfully scanned, your WhatsApp account will automatically appear on the desktop app. You will see your chats, contacts, and media syncing to your computer. After successfully scanning the QR code, your WhatsApp account will be linked to the desktop app. You can now send and receive messages, share files, and make calls from your computer. The desktop app mirrors all the conversations and contacts from your phone, ensuring that everything stays synchronized. Remember, your phone needs to maintain an active internet connection for the desktop app to function correctly. If your phone loses internet connectivity, the desktop app will disconnect until the connection is restored. You can link multiple devices to your WhatsApp account, allowing you to use WhatsApp on different computers simultaneously. Simply repeat the linking process on each device. To remove a linked device, go to the "Linked Devices" section in your WhatsApp settings on your phone. You will see a list of all the devices connected to your account. Tap on the device you want to remove and select the "Log Out" option. The device will be unlinked from your account.
Troubleshooting Common Login Issues
Encountering issues while trying to log in to WhatsApp on your Windows computer can be frustrating, but don't worry, there are several common problems and solutions that can help you get back on track. Let's explore some of these issues and how to resolve them.
First, ensure that your phone has a stable internet connection. The WhatsApp desktop app mirrors your phone's account, so if your phone is offline, the desktop app won't work. Check your Wi-Fi or mobile data connection to ensure it is stable and active. If you are having trouble with your internet connection, try restarting your Wi-Fi router or contacting your mobile carrier for assistance. Another common problem is an outdated version of WhatsApp on your phone. Make sure you have the latest version installed from the app store. Outdated versions may not be compatible with the desktop app, causing login issues. Check the app store for any available updates and install them. Sometimes, the QR code on the desktop app may not scan correctly. This can be due to poor lighting, a damaged QR code, or a problem with your phone's camera. Ensure that the QR code is well-lit and clearly visible on your computer screen. Try cleaning your phone's camera lens to improve the scanning quality. If the issue persists, try restarting both your phone and the desktop app. If you are still experiencing problems, try reinstalling the WhatsApp desktop app. This can resolve any corrupted files or installation errors that may be causing login issues. Uninstall the app from your computer and then download and install the latest version from the official WhatsApp website. Firewalls and antivirus software can sometimes interfere with the WhatsApp desktop app, preventing it from connecting to the internet or scanning the QR code. Check your firewall and antivirus settings to ensure that WhatsApp is allowed to access the internet and is not being blocked. Temporarily disable your firewall or antivirus software to see if it resolves the issue. If it does, you may need to add WhatsApp to the list of allowed programs in your firewall or antivirus settings. Sometimes, the WhatsApp servers may be experiencing temporary issues or downtime. This can prevent you from logging in to the desktop app. Check the WhatsApp status page or social media channels for any announcements about server outages. If there is a known issue, wait for it to be resolved before trying to log in again. If you have tried all of the above solutions and are still experiencing login issues, you can try contacting WhatsApp support for assistance. They may be able to provide you with more specific troubleshooting steps or identify any underlying issues with your account. Go to the WhatsApp website or app and look for the "Contact Us" or "Help" section to find information on how to reach out to WhatsApp support. Be sure to provide them with as much detail as possible about the issue you are experiencing, including any error messages or screenshots. Exploring WhatsApp Windows Features
Once you've successfully logged into WhatsApp on your Windows computer, a whole new world of features opens up, making your messaging experience more convenient and efficient. Let's explore some of the key features that WhatsApp Windows has to offer.
First and foremost, the most obvious advantage of using WhatsApp on your computer is the larger screen and keyboard. This makes typing messages much faster and more comfortable, especially for longer conversations. You can also easily view and manage your chats, contacts, and media files on the larger display. Sharing files is a breeze with WhatsApp Windows. You can simply drag and drop files from your computer into the chat window, making it quick and easy to send documents, photos, videos, and other files to your contacts. This is especially useful for sharing files that are stored on your computer. Making voice and video calls on WhatsApp Windows is just as easy as on your phone. You can enjoy clear and high-quality calls with your contacts directly from your computer. The larger screen makes video calls more immersive, and you can use a headset or microphone for better audio quality. WhatsApp Windows also supports group chats, allowing you to communicate with multiple contacts simultaneously. You can create and manage groups, send messages, share files, and make group voice or video calls. This is a great way to stay connected with friends, family, or colleagues. WhatsApp Windows offers the same end-to-end encryption as the mobile app, ensuring that your messages and calls are secure and private. Your conversations are protected from eavesdropping, and only you and the recipient can read or hear them. You can customize the appearance of WhatsApp Windows to suit your preferences. You can change the chat background, choose a theme, and adjust the font size to make the app more visually appealing and comfortable to use. WhatsApp Windows also offers desktop notifications, so you can stay up-to-date on your messages and calls even when the app is not in focus. You can customize the notification settings to control when and how you receive notifications. WhatsApp Windows is constantly being updated with new features and improvements, so you can always expect to see new and exciting additions to the app. Keep an eye out for updates to take advantage of the latest features and enhancements. WhatsApp Windows seamlessly syncs with your phone, so you can access your messages, contacts, and media files on both devices. This allows you to switch between your phone and computer without losing any data or conversations.
